Abstract
The invention discloses a kind of single-component cranny filler of polyurethane foam, its raw material includes following components by weight: 30.0-60.0 parts of polyether polyol, 2.0-6.0 parts of catalyst, 1.0-4.0 parts of curing agent, 2.0-6.0 parts of plasticizer, 20.0-40.0 parts of solvent, this single-component cranny filler of polyurethane foam, have good flexibility and tensile strength, uniform foam cell, it can use at low ambient temperatures, contain DMDEE catalyst in its inside, activity is milder, storage stability is good, the surface drying rate of OCF can be effectively facilitated, solidification rate and frothing percentage, contain CP52 plasticizer in its inside, compatibility is good, it can reduce the viscosity and brittleness of OCF, increase its flexibility, it is internal added with ketimine cured dose, it can reduce the viscosity of OCF , make its rapid moisturecuring, improve its tensile strength.

Technical field
The present invention relates to technical field of polymer, specially a kind of single-component cranny filler of polyurethane foam.
Background technique
Single-component cranny filler of polyurethane foam is by components such as base polyurethane prepolymer for use as, catalyst, foaming agent, propellants with list
A kind of special polyurethane products of branch inhalator jar form package storage have many advantages, such as that preceding foaming, high expansion, contraction are small, and
Foam of the intensity of foam well, after bonding force high solidification has the multi-effects such as joint filling, bonding, sealing, heat-insulated, sound-absorbing, is
A kind of environmental protection and energy saving, construction material easy to use are applicable to sealing and plugging, fill a vacancy and squeegee, fix bonding, heat preservation and soundproof,
The sealing and plugging and waterproof being particularly suitable between plastic-steel or aluminum alloy doors and windows and wall;
In the prior art: application publication number is that the patent of 107880239 A of CN discloses a kind of monocomponent polyurethane foam
Gap filler, the raw material including following mass fraction: polyether polyol 10-15%, modified polyether polylol 5-10%, fire retardant
40-50%, catalyst 1-2%, foam stabilizer 6-10%, polymethylene polyphenyl Isocyanate 15-25%, dimethyl ether 2-5% are pushed away
Into agent 3-5%, the polyether polyol includes: polyether polyol A, viscosity 40-80mPa.s, hydroxyl value 260-300mg
KOH/g and polyether polyol B, viscosity 220-300mPa.s, hydroxyl value are 160-170mg KOH/g, can not be compared with low temperature
It is used under degree environment, use scope is narrow, and flexibility is poor, and poor tensile strength, abscess is not uniform enough, and it is impossible to meet use demands.
Summary of the invention
The technical problem to be solved by the present invention is to overcome the existing defects, provides a kind of monocomponent polyurethane foam joint filling
Agent can use at low ambient temperatures, and use scope is wide, and flexibility is good, and tensile strength is strong, uniform foam cell, can effectively solve
The problems in background technique.
To achieve the above object, the invention provides the following technical scheme: a kind of single-component cranny filler of polyurethane foam, former
Material by weight include following components: 30.0-60.0 parts of polyether polyol, 2.0-6.0 parts of catalyst, 1.0-4.0 parts of curing agent,
2.0-6.0 parts of plasticizer, 20.0-40.0 parts of solvent.
The pol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, and molecular weight exists
Between 400.0-3000.0.
As a preferred technical solution of the present invention, the catalyst is DMDEE.
As a preferred technical solution of the present invention, the plasticizer CP52.
As a preferred technical solution of the present invention, the curing agent is ketimide.
As a preferred technical solution of the present invention, the solvent includes DME and LPG.
Compared with prior art, the beneficial effects of the present invention are: this single-component cranny filler of polyurethane foam, has good
Flexibility and tensile strength, uniform foam cell can use at low ambient temperatures, internal to contain DMDEE catalyst, and activity is more soft
It is good with storage stability, surface drying rate, solidification rate and the frothing percentage of OCF can be effectively facilitated, it is internal to be plasticized containing CP52
Agent, compatibility is good, can reduce the viscosity and brittleness of OCF, increases its flexibility, internal to be added with ketimine cured dose,
The viscosity that can reduce OCF makes its rapid moisturecuring, improves its tensile strength.

Embodiment one
A kind of single-component cranny filler of polyurethane foam, raw material include following components by weight: polyether polyol 30.0
Part, 2.0 parts of DMDEE catalyst, ketimine cured dose 1.0 parts, 2.0 parts of CP52 plasticizer, 20.0 parts of solvent.
Pol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, molecular weight 400.0.
Solvent includes DME and LPG.
In the present embodiment, 2.0 parts of DMDEE catalyst, ketimine cured dose 1.0 parts, 2.0 parts of CP52 plasticizer, at this point, should
The poor tensile strength of single-component cranny filler of polyurethane foam.
Embodiment two
A kind of single-component cranny filler of polyurethane foam, raw material include following components by weight: polyether polyol 40.0
Part, 3.0 parts of DMDEE catalyst, ketimine cured dose 2.0 parts, 3.0 parts of CP52 plasticizer, 25.0 parts of solvent.
Pol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, molecular weight 1000.0.
Solvent includes DME and LPG.
In the present embodiment, pol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, molecular weight
It is 1000.0, service performance is poor at low ambient temperatures for the single-component cranny filler of polyurethane foam.
Embodiment three
A kind of single-component cranny filler of polyurethane foam, raw material include following components by weight: polyether polyol 50.0
Part, 5.0 parts of DMDEE catalyst, ketimine cured dose 3.0 parts, 5.0 parts of CP52 plasticizer, 30.0 parts of solvent.
Pol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, molecular weight 2000.0.
Solvent includes DME and LPG.
In the present embodiment, 5.0 parts of DMDEE catalyst, ketimine cured dose 3.0 parts, 5.0 parts of CP52 plasticizer, at this point, should
The tensile strength of single-component cranny filler of polyurethane foam is general.
Example IV
A kind of single-component cranny filler of polyurethane foam, raw material include following components by weight: polyether polyol 60.0
Part, 6.0 parts of DMDEE catalyst, ketimine cured dose 4.0 parts, 6.0 parts of CP52 plasticizer, 40.0 parts of solvent.
Polyether polyol is two degrees of functionality and three-functionality-degree in 1.0: 1.0 ratios mixing gained, molecular weight 3000.0.
Solvent includes DME and LPG.
In the present embodiment, 6.0 parts of DMDEE catalyst, ketimine cured dose 4.0 parts, 6.0 parts of CP52 plasticizer, at this point, should
The flexibility and tensile strength of single-component cranny filler of polyurethane foam are best, uniform foam cell.
